The OA1ZHA22C is a high-performance operational amplifier (op-amp) from STMicroelectronics, designed for a wide range of applications in the electronics industry. This IC op-amp features a zero-drift technology, ensuring excellent long-term stability and drift performance. With a supply voltage range of 1.8 V to 5.5 V, the OA1ZHA22C is suitable for low-voltage applications. It offers a gain bandwidth product of 400 kHz, making it ideal for high-speed signal processing.
The OA1ZHA22C stands out from similar models due to its low input bias current of 70 pA, low voltage input offset of 1 µV, and low supply current of 31 µA. These features make it an excellent choice for precision applications where low noise and high accuracy are critical.
